modulation response of Laser Cavity Solitons (LCSs) in lasers with saturable absorbers is investigated. Simulations show that two resonance peaks are available in the modulation response of these LCSs and the following peaks are just the harmonics of the first two. Using the control parameter related to the life ratio of photons to carries in absorber and amplifier media, the behavior of the LCSs is studied. It is shown that the mobility of LCSs in response to modulations is enhanced and this is remarkable when the modulation frequency coincides with that of the resonance. Also, a comparison is made for the velocity in the case of no-modulation and modulation with the frequency of the second peak (14.85 GHz).
